On 11/9/2022 at 8:18 PM, birdylady said:

Qu.  Does Mariner have a craps table in the casino?  And if they do, are you finding it being manned and used?

thanx 

Erika

They have a craps table. When I walked past tonight around 1030 there was nobody playing and the crew seemed to be training.

 

I'm not sure if they were training because nobody was playing or if nobody was playing because they were training. 

 

I will check again tomorrow.

Veterans appreciation gathering in the Promenade.

 

20221111_105833-X2.jpg

 

The CD, captain and senior officers were all here. The orchestra played some patriotic tunes as we said our thanks to the veterans for their service.

 

We have a WWII vet in the crowd.

 

Very moving and a nice turnout.

The line for dinner was short. Unless you had a reservation. That line was backed up to the elevator lobby.

 

The couple in front of me have assigned dining but asked to eat here. They were accomadated. That irritates me as someone who prefers to eat around 6 without being boxed into assigned dining. I have never been accommodated even with a half empty assigned early seating.

 

I politely mentioned my frustration with the system they have when the host mentioned I've only come twice for dinner. He didn't even pretend to care lol.
